The Real Estate Market in Vaucluse

Vaucluse is renowned for its charming hilltop villages, dynamic cities, and stunning natural landscapes. The region attracts many buyers looking for a home in the sun, offering an exceptional living environment without the exorbitant prices of some other regions in the south of France. Its proximity to the metropolises of Marseille and Montpellier, along with many communes (around forty) being eligible for the Pinel law (for rental investment), boosts its real estate market.

The market, primarily sought after by buyers looking for a secondary residence or a house to change their lifestyle or retire, is mainly composed of:

  • Provençal mas and bastides
  • Villas with pools
  • Renovated farms and vineyard properties
  • Village houses
  • New ecological houses

Price per Square Meter in Vaucluse

In 2024, the average price per square meter for a house in Vaucluse is €2900. Here's an overview of prices in different areas:

Locality Price/m²
Apt 2,400 €/m²
Châteauneuf-du-Pape 2,600 €/m²
Mornas 2,000 €/m²
Bédoin 3,200 €/m²
Orange 2,600 €/m²
Mondragon 2,200 €/m²
Althen-des-Paluds 3,000 €/m²
Sainte-Cécile-les-Vignes 2 600 €/m²
Cheval-Blanc 3,400 €/m²
Visan 2,400 €/m²
Gordes 6,800 €/m²
L'Isle-sur-la-Sorgue 3,500 €/m²
Avignon 2,400 €/m²

Evolution of Real Estate Prices in Vaucluse

The real estate market in Vaucluse has seen steady growth over the past few years. However, similar to national trends, prices have slightly decreased in 2024 after a post-pandemic rise. This decline is not uniform, and some properties, especially character houses and those in highly sought-after areas, maintain high prices.

The Best Cities to Buy in the Vaucluse

1. Avignon

Famous for its Palais des Papes, its art festival, and its bridge, Avignon is a vibrant city with a rich historical heritage. Ideal for those who wish to combine culture and comfort of life, it offers a variety of real estate, ranging from modern apartments in the city center to old houses in the outskirts.

2. Gordes

Ranked among the most beautiful villages in France, Gordes is the jewel of the Luberon. With its cobbled streets and stone houses, it attracts buyers seeking authenticity and charm. Prices are high, but the investment is worth it.

3. L'Isle-sur-la-Sorgue

Known for its canals and antique markets, L'Isle-sur-la-Sorgue is a popular destination for its idyllic setting and lively cultural life. It's an excellent choice for those seeking a balance between tranquility and activity.

4. Apt

Located in the heart of the Luberon, Apt is known for its markets and Provençal atmosphere. It offers more affordable prices than its touristy neighbors while allowing easy access to the wonders of the Luberon.

5. Vaison-la-Romaine

Famous for its Roman ruins, Vaison-la-Romaine combines history, culture, and nature. The town offers a pleasant living environment with reasonable real estate prices, thus attracting a diverse population.
